The Samsung Galaxy A23 5G, released in late 2022, and the Samsung Galaxy S23 Ultra, launched in early 2023, are two distinct smartphones from Samsung's lineup, each designed to cater to different user needs. While both operate on the Android platform with Samsung's One UI, the S23 Ultra is positioned as a premium device with advanced features and top-tier performance, whereas the A23 5G offers essential modern smartphone capabilities in a more accessible package. Key differences are evident in their display technology, camera systems, and overall processing power.

User feedback for the Galaxy A23 5G often highlights its reliable performance for everyday tasks and its long-lasting battery as key strengths. Users appreciate its 120Hz display for smooth scrolling, especially considering its positioning. Common criticisms sometimes point to its camera performance in challenging lighting conditions and the absence of an official water resistance rating. Overall, it is seen as a practical device for general use. [12]
The Galaxy S23 Ultra receives widespread praise for its exceptional camera system, particularly its zoom capabilities and low-light performance. Users consistently commend its powerful processing, vibrant display, and extended battery life, often noting it can comfortably last a full day of heavy use. The integrated S Pen is also a significant draw for productivity-focused users. Some common concerns include its large size and weight, which can make one-handed use challenging, and the curved screen design, which some users find makes screen protectors difficult to apply. Users prioritizing a device for general communication, social media, and casual content consumption, who value a headphone jack and a solid battery life, may find the Galaxy A23 5G well-suited to their needs. For those who require top-tier camera capabilities, powerful performance for demanding applications, a highly detailed and bright display, and the unique functionality of a stylus, the Galaxy S23 Ultra aligns more closely with those priorities.
